ELIXIR Norway
ELIXIR is a European infrastructure for bioinformatics (www.elixir-europe.org) with 21 member countries. In addition, the EMBL is a member. The Norwegian Node – ELIXIR Norway – is lead from the University of Bergen and is funded by the Research Council of Norway and the five partner institutions (University of Bergen, University of Oslo, Norwegian University of Science and Technology – NTNU, University of Tromsø and Norwegian University of Life Sciences – NMBU). ELIXIR provides services within bioinformatics to users all over the world. The Norwegian Node is responsible for some of these services and offers also a broader spectrum of services towards Norwegian users (see www.elixir-norway.org/ and www.bioinfo.no/)

Administrative coordinator (senior advisor)
We now call for applicants to a newly established coordinator position at the University of Bergen. The position is permanent, funded by external activity, and is placed at the Department of Informatics within the Computational Biology Unit (CBU) – a centre hosted by the Department of Informatics (www.cbu.uib.no). The coordinator will report to the head of CBU and the head of ELIXIR Norway (currently the same person). Some travelling will be required.
